      Yes! I think I just unarchived the two videos on pencils. Haha 😂 a whole video on pencils and I could speak for hours on it. But basically you can imagine pencils in five categories from hard to soft. Hard or firm pencils have graphite that’s hard and doesn’t smear and is typically lighter and gives thinner lines for the most part. A number 2 pencil is right in the middle and soft pencils have soft graphite which means they mark easily and darkly and smear. It’s great for drawing but not necessarily writing unless you have a youngish child with light grip and touch.
